They do consider everything released before the 31st. That's why the Aviator is number one on the list even though it isn't in widespread release till Christmas day.

Also of note, must be American made, at least 60 minutes, and a fictional narrative. That knocks out farenheit, supersize me, Miracle, and the Passion (unless people really want to beat that hornet nest and say the Passion was fictional).

Friday Night Lights wasn't a non-fictional account to my best knowledge. I'm pretty sure it was a dramatization of the author's experiences, not a non-fictional piece.
